How to Keep Track of School Assignments

Success in school requires organization. Oftentimes, a student's class grade is based on assignments that are completed at home. Teachers usually check to see if assignments are completed properly and on time. The following tips will help to keep track of all those school assignments.

Difficulty: Easy
Instructions
  1. Step 1

    Create an assignment notebook. Assignment notebooks can help you track your school assignments. On each page of the notebook, write the date. Under each date, write the class, the assignment and the due date of the assignment. As you complete each assignment, check it off. School assignment notebooks can also be purchased from stores such as Staples.

  2. Step 2

    Purchase two-pocket folders for each class. Label one side of the pocket "To Do" and the other side "Completed." At the end of each class, place any assignments that need to be completed in the "To Do" pocket. As you complete the assignment, transfer it to the "Completed" side.

  3. Step 3

    Purchase a small calendar. One that fits in your school bag would work great. Write due dates of assignments on the calendar. As you complete each assignment, cross it off.

  4. Step 4

    Have a set place to do homework. Place an "in" box and "out" box on your workspace. Place assignments that need to be completed in the "in" box and place assignments that are finished in the "out" box. Be sure to pack your bag when you are done working and include all items in the “out" box.

Tips & Warnings
  • Don't wait until the last-minute to complete school assignments. Rushing through assignments is a bad habit to start.
